Still have to figure out the brake problem, the back brakes want to lock up, only the weight of the camper keeps them from locking up.  New booster and master cylinder, brakes front n back.  He says he played with the proportional valve but that's my next step.

I check out the proportional valve the piston and needle in there were fine, I pulled off the back wheels and found the longer brake shoe in the front.  Swapped them around the way they should be and brakes work like a champ.  thanks for the suggestions, I appreciate it.
